How to Choose the Best Wheel Spacers for Trucks and SUVs in 2026?
Choosing the right wheel spacer requires understanding several technical factors that affect safety, performance, and longevity. This guide breaks down what matters most for truck and SUV applications.
Hub-Centric vs Lug-Centric: Which Design is Safer?
Hub-centric spacers center on the wheel hub’s raised center portion, carrying vehicle weight through the hub rather than the lug nuts. This design eliminates vibration and reduces stress on lug studs. Lug-centric spacers rely entirely on lug nuts to center the wheel, requiring precise tightening technique to avoid imbalance.
For trucks and SUVs that see highway speeds and carry heavy loads, hub-centric designs are strongly preferred. The forum research consistently showed hub-centric spacers generate fewer vibration complaints and hold torque better over time. The small price premium is worth the safety margin for daily-driven vehicles.
That said, lug-centric designs can work if properly installed. The key is gradual tightening in a star pattern, multiple torque checks during the first 500 miles, and regular retorque maintenance. For dedicated off-road rigs that rarely see pavement, lug-centric spacers from reputable brands may be acceptable.
Material Matters: Forged vs Cast Aluminum
Wheel spacers use either cast or forged 6061-T6 aluminum. Cast aluminum is poured into molds and cooled, creating potential for internal porosity and inconsistent grain structure. Forged aluminum is mechanically worked under pressure, aligning the grain structure and eliminating voids.
The result is significant: forged spacers typically offer 30-40% greater strength than cast equivalents of the same alloy. For heavy trucks and vehicles that tow, this strength margin matters when hitting potholes or rough roads. The DYNOFIT and KSP forged options on this list provide superior material quality compared to economy cast spacers.
Steel spacers like the Rough Country 0.25-inch option offer a different tradeoff. Steel is heavier but has excellent fatigue resistance and strength. For thin spacers where weight is not a concern, steel can be an excellent budget choice.
Thickness Guide: What Size Spacer Do You Need?
Spacer thickness determines how far your wheels move outward. Common sizes and their applications:
0.25-0.5 inch: Solves minor clearance issues like brake caliper interference or slight tire rubbing on control arms. Minimal impact on wheel bearings and suspension geometry. Best for functional clearance fixes rather than stance.
1.0-1.5 inch: The sweet spot for most applications. Provides noticeable stance improvement, clears larger tires, and moves wheels flush with body lines on most trucks. Still within safe limits for wheel bearing longevity when using quality spacers.
1.75-2.0 inch: Aggressive stance territory. Significantly changes track width and suspension geometry. Requires careful attention to hardware quality and more frequent maintenance. Best for show trucks and dedicated off-road builds where appearance or extreme tire clearance justifies the tradeoffs.
Bolt Pattern and Center Bore Compatibility
Your spacer must match your vehicle’s bolt pattern exactly. Common truck and SUV patterns include:
5×5 (5x127mm): Jeep Wrangler JL/JLU, Gladiator JT, Grand Cherokee
6×5.5 (6×139.7mm): Toyota Tacoma, 4Runner, Tundra, Chevy/GMC 1500, Ram 1500
6x135mm: Ford F-150, Expedition
8×6.5 (8×165.1mm): Chevy/GMC 2500/3500, Ram 2500/3500, Ford F-250/F-350
Center bore diameter is equally critical for hub-centric fitment. Measure your hub’s center diameter and verify the spacer matches. Mismatched center bores defeat the hub-centric design and create vibration issues.
Hardware Grade: Why Stud Quality Cannot Be Compromised
Wheel spacer studs come in various grades, with 10.9 and 12.9 being most common for quality products. The grading system indicates tensile strength and yield strength, with higher numbers indicating stronger steel.
Grade 10.9 studs provide approximately 1,000 MPa tensile strength and are adequate for most applications. Grade 12.9 offers about 1,200 MPa tensile strength, providing extra margin for heavy loads and extreme use. The premium Spidertrax 4140 Chromoly studs exceed even 12.9 specifications in fatigue resistance.
Always verify that your lug nuts have adequate thread engagement with the spacer’s studs. A minimum of 6-8 full turns of thread engagement is required for safety. With thicker spacers, you may need extended thread (ET) lug nuts to achieve proper engagement.

Is it okay to use wheel spacers on a truck?
Yes, wheel spacers are safe for trucks when properly installed with quality hub-centric designs from reputable brands. The key factors are correct fitment for your bolt pattern, hub bore, and load rating. Use Grade 10.9 or higher hardware, retorque after 50-100 miles initially, and check torque periodically. Quality spacers from brands like KSP, Spidertrax, and Rough Country are used successfully by thousands of truck owners for daily driving, towing, and off-roading.
Are spacers safe for SUVs?
Wheel spacers are safe for SUVs following the same guidelines as trucks. Choose hub-centric spacers that match your vehicle’s bolt pattern and center bore exactly. SUVs benefit from the improved stability that wider track width provides, particularly for towing and highway driving. Ensure proper installation with a torque wrench and thread locker, and retorque at recommended intervals. SUVs with independent rear suspension may see more pronounced handling changes than solid-axle trucks.
Which wheel spacers are safest?
The safest wheel spacers share these characteristics: hub-centric design with precise center bore fitment, forged 6061-T6 aluminum construction, Grade 10.9 or higher studs (12.9 or Chromoly preferred), proper heat treatment and coating for corrosion resistance, and installation with thread locker and correct torque specifications. Top-rated options include KSP Performance with 5mm reinforced hub rings, Spidertrax with 4140 Chromoly studs, and quality forged options from DYNOFIT.
What are the risks of wheel spacers?
The main risks of wheel spacers include wheel bearing wear from increased leverage, potential for wheel separation if improperly installed, suspension geometry changes affecting handling, and warranty concerns with some manufacturers. These risks are minimized by using quality hub-centric spacers, proper installation with a torque wrench, regular retorque maintenance, and staying within moderate thicknesses (1-2 inches) for daily-driven vehicles. The bearing wear impact is comparable to running wheels with equivalent offset.
Can spacers ruin your axles?
Properly installed quality wheel spacers will not ruin your axles. The added leverage from increased track width does increase stress on wheel bearings and suspension components, but this is comparable to running wheels with equivalent offset. To minimize axle and bearing stress, use hub-centric spacers, stay within moderate thicknesses (under 2 inches for daily driving), ensure proper torque and thread engagement, and maintain regular retorque schedules. Extreme thickness spacers (over 2 inches) combined with aggressive off-roading and oversized tires will accelerate wear on all drivetrain components.
